Breadth Positive and Leadership Improved Behind Gains

Stocks finished higher Thursday. The Dow added 91 points to 25,717 while the S&P 500 gained 10 points to 2,815. The Nasdaq Composite was up 25 points to 7,669. The volume totals reported were lighter on the NYSE and on the Nasdaq exchange. Breadth was positive as advancers led decliners by a 2-1 margin on the NYSE and nearly 2-1 on the Nasdaq exchange. A total of 34 high-ranked companies from the Leaders List hit new 52-week highs and were listed on the BreakOuts Page, versus 27 on the prior session. New 52-week highs outnumbered new 52-week lows on the NYSE and on the Nasdaq exchange. The major indices (M criteria) saw their uptrend come under pressure recently, however, healthy market leadership (stocks hitting new highs) remains a reassuring signThFeatured Stocks Page provides the most timely analysis on high-ranked leaders.

The major averages posted modest gains as investors digested the latest trade reports. An update this morning indicated that the U.S. and China had made significant progress in all areas amid high level negotiations. An additional release suggested Chinese leaders are willing to increase market access to foreign financial institutions. On the data front, the final reading of fourth-quarter GDP was downwardly revised from 2.6% to 2.2%, which matched consensus estimates. Additional surveys showed initial jobless claims ticked down to 211,000 in the most recent week while pending home sales slipped 1.0% in February.

Nine of 11 S&P 500 sectors finished higher with Utilities and Communication Services the laggards. The Industrial and Materials groups paced gains in sympathy with the positive trade updates. Financials also posted solid gains as treasury yields rebounded from multi-year lows. In earnings news, PVH Corp (PVH +14.76%) and Lululemon (LULU +14.13%) after both apparel makers bested analyst earnings projections.

Treasury prices fell from 15-month highs as the yield on the 10-year note ended the session unchanged at 2.38%, after trading as low as 2.34% overnight. In commodities, NYMEX WTI crude was little changed at $59.39/barrel. COMEX gold eased 1.5% to $1,290.60/ounce amid a stronger dollar.

Financial, Retail, and Oil Services Indexes Rose

Financial groups posted gains as the Bank Index ($BKX +1.18%) and the Broker/Dealer Index ($XBD +0.86%) both rose, and thRetail Index ($RLX +0.30%) also edged higher. The tech sector had a positive bias as the Biotech Index ($BTK +1.03%) outpaced the Networking Index ($NWX +0.61%) but the Semiconductor Index ($SOX -0.19%) finished with a small loss. Commodity-linked groups were mixed as the Oil Services Index ($OSX +1.62%) rose while the Integrated Oil Index ($XOI -0.10%) ended slightly in the red, and the Gold & Silver Index ($XAU -2.56%) was a standout decliner.

Breakway Gap Backed by More Than 6 Times Average Volume

Often, when a leading stock is setting up to breakout of a solid base it is highlighted in the FACTBASEDINVESTING.com Mid-Day Breakouts Report. Sometimes stocks are highlighted shortly after a technical breakout, yet while the potential buy candidate may still be considered action-worthy. The most relevant factors are noted in the report which alerts prudent CANSLIM oriented investors to place the issue in their watch list. After doing any necessary backup research, the investor is prepared to act after the stock triggers a technical buy signal (breaks above its pivot point on more than +40% above average turnover) but before it gets too extended from a sound base. In the event the stock fails to trigger a technical buy signal and its price declines then it will simply be removed from the watch list. Disciplined investors know to buy as near as possible to the pivot point and avoid chasing stocks after they have rallied more than +5% above their pivot point. It is crucial to always limit losses whenever any stock heads the wrong direction, and disciplined investors sell if a struggling stock ever falls more than -7% from their purchase price.

Lululemon Athletica (LULU +$20.74 or +14.13% to $167.54) was highlighted in yellow with pivot point cited based on its 10/01/18 high plus 10 cents in the earlier mid-day report (read here). It hit a new high with today's "breakaway gap" and big volume-driven gain triggering a technical buy signal. Longtime members may recall that a breakaway gap is one noted exception to the rule that investors should not chase a stock more than +5% above prior highs, however, risk increases the further above the pivot point one buys any stock.

LULU reported Jan '19 earnings +39% on +26% sales revenues, marking its 5th consecutive quarterly comparison above the +25% minimum guideline (C criteria). Recent quarterly comparisons showed encouraging acceleration in sales revenues and earnings improvement helping it match with the fact-based investment system's fundamental guidelines. It has a new CEO as of 8/20/18. It currently has an 84 Earnings Per Share Rating. Its Timeliness rating is B and Sponsorship rating is C.

The number of top-rated funds owning its shares rose from 417 in Sep '11 to 1,200 in Dec '18, a good sign concerning the I criteria. LULU was first featured in yellow at $23.83 (split adjusted after 2:1 split effective 7/21/11) in the October 8, 2010 mid-day report report (read here) and it traded up as much as +163.7% in a little more than 9 months.
